Following the deadly fire at Gul Plaza in Karachi, the Sindh Building Control Authority (SBCA) sealed Rimpa Plaza, located next to the shopping mall, on Wednesday.
The tragic fire incident at Gul Plaza, located on M.A. Jinnah Road, claims at least 28 deaths so far, with dozens reported missing. This major fire incident at Gul Plaza has made Rimpa Plaza, which is already over four decades old, unstable and unsafe.
After conducting a joint visit by Sindh Building Control Authority (SBCA) officials and senior Pakistan Engineering Council engineer Arif Qasim, the building was sealed off for measures to ensure public safety. SBCA issued a notice to the owners and occupants, declaring the structure damaged, unsafe, and dangerous. Several portions of Gul Plaza collapsed during the fire, with debris falling onto the ramp area of Rimpa Plaza and damaging its structural columns.
The inspectors declared that the affected part of Rimpa Plaza was highly hazardous to human life and property. The owners were instructed to immediately terminate the use of the affected area and dismantle dangerous structural elements. SBCA also ordered that repair and strengthening work be done under the supervision of a qualified structural engineer, in line with building laws and regulations.
On the other hand, management of Rimpa Plaza denied that the building is unsafe. The representatives of the management had to say that the overall structural integrity is intact and that damage is limited to a wall in the parking ramp caused by falling debris from Gul Plaza. They termed reports to the contrary to be baseless and misleading.
